Excellence in Preventive Care

It makes sense to do everything possible to prevent disease! Our systematic approach to all aspects of preventive pet healthcare can avoid unnecessary pain and suffering that will keep pet healthcare costs to a minimum over the lifespan of your pet. WTVC doctors combined attend over 6 to 8 continuing education seminars a year. Our top priority topics include: updates on tick carried diseases, safest and most effective vaccinations, preventing obesity, and preventing anxiety in pets during visits. Our Drs and staff are committed to preventive care to help your pets live longer and feel better while reducing your pet care costs.

Our 10 Core Wellness Principles

Lifestyle-based vaccines

Up-to-date and safe vaccines according to your pet’s lifestyle.

Heartworm prevention

A preventive focus that supports year-round protection for pets.

Parasite programs

Programs to help prevent intestinal worms, fleas, and ticks.

Preventive dentistry

A dental prevention approach designed to reduce pain and future costs.

Breed specific wellness

Breed specific wellness testing to help identify problems early.

Ideal weight support

Weight and body condition assessments to help pets feel better and live longer.

Evidence-based nutrition

Evidence-based food and supplement guidance to support wellness.

In-house lab testing

Reliable in-house testing to save time and help detect disease early.

Modern monitoring

State of the art anesthetic monitoring and medical equipment.

Electronic records

Electronic medical records for rapid access to information.
